Keyondra Lockett Releases "Beautiful" & Launches Campaign to Eradicate Breast Cancer

Urban Contemporary gospel artist Keyondra Lockett has launched The Beautiful Experience campaign to help eradicate breast cancer. As part of the campaign, Lockett has released a new single "Beautiful" on iTunes, Amazon Muisc and all other digital outlets.The Beautiful Experience campaign was inspired by the song "Beautiful" written by Keyondra with the objective of inspiring women of all walks of life to become aware of their worth and value as well as their inner and outer beauty, regardless of the circumstances life brings. "We are aware of the toll chemo therapy can inflict on ones outer beauty, ultimately affecting how a woman facing those outer changes can feel inside as it relates to her self esteem. Therefore we want to include breast cancer survivors in our quest to help women realize the innermost beauty," states Keyondra. Additionally, 10% of the proceeds from "Beautiful" during the campaign period starting June 9, 2017 will be donated to The Susan G. Komen Greater Atlanta Foundation in an effort to help fight breast cancer. The campaign encompasses during the 3 month period the following lineup: *1.Social media appeal with posts featuring videos of women stating what makes them beautiful and men stating what they feel makes women beautiful and a lyric video of the song posted on Keyondra's website and social media. *2. Keyondra will visit and sing "Beautiful" to girls and women at Hospitals, Transitional homes and churches as well as in concerts featuring her during the campaign period. *3. A live stream acoustic guitar session of the song "Beautiful" with Keyondra and Christian artist, acoustic guitarist Jokia Williams June 16,2017 on Facebook at 7:30pm CST. *4.
